Método Iasphelp::get_ErrorDscp
A propriedade ErrorDscp permite que uma página da Web ASP converta um código de erro em uma cadeia de caracteres descritiva.
Sintaxe
HRESULT get_ErrorDscp(
[in] long lErrCode,
[out] BSTR *pVal
);
Parâmetros
lErrCode [in]
Especifica o código de erro a ser convertido em uma cadeia de caracteres descritiva.
pVal [out]
Um ponteiro fornecido pelo chamador para um local que recebe a cadeia de caracteres descritiva que corresponde ao código de erro no parâmetro lErrCode .
Retornar valor
Códigos de erro win32 também podem ser retornados.
Código de retorno | Descrição |
---|---|
S_OK | A operação foi realizada com êxito. |
E_HANDLE | O método Iasphelp::Open não foi chamado. |
E_POINTER | Ponteiro pVal inválido. |
E_OUTOFMEMORY | Sem memória. |
Exemplo de VBScript
O método Iasphelp::Open deve ser chamado antes que a propriedade Iasphelp::ErrorDscp possa ser consultada.
Dim objPrinter, ErrorCode, ErrorString
strPrinter = Session("MS_printer")
Set objPrinter = Server.CreateObject ("OlePrn.AspHelp")
objPrinter.Open strPrinter
...
' Get error code.
...
ErrorString = objPrinter.ErrorDscp(ErrorCode)
Requisitos
Plataforma de destino: Desktop